Output 373b3930429c05d16316a737cd60d48b9b2dd4d5e4fac57e703d5b10f1f65521:63

value
5000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 efab84b23da842582beb694cca763f155981099750abf4e4ff99cc2122245327
address
bc1pa74cfv3a4pp9s2ltd9xv5a3lz4vczzvh2z4lfe8ln8xzzg3y2vnsegk0zq
transaction
373b3930429c05d16316a737cd60d48b9b2dd4d5e4fac57e703d5b10f1f65521
spent
true